Frequently Asked Questions About Funeral Homes in Oil Springs

Common questions about funeral services and funeral homes in Oil Springs, Kentucky.

Q1.What types of funeral services are typically offered by funeral homes in Oil Springs, Kentucky?

Funeral homes in Oil Springs, KY, often provide traditional funeral services, graveside services, and cremation options. Many also offer personalized memorials that reflect the region's values, such as incorporating local traditions or scenic outdoor settings common in Johnson County. It's best to consult directly with a local funeral home to discuss specific service packages.

Q2.How much does a funeral typically cost in Oil Springs, and what factors influence the price?

In Oil Springs, KY, the average cost for a traditional funeral can range from $7,000 to $10,000, depending on services selected. Factors include the type of service (e.g., burial vs. cremation), casket choice, and additional options like transportation or obituaries. Kentucky law requires funeral homes to provide itemized price lists, so you can compare costs transparently.

Q3.Are there any local regulations in Oil Springs or Kentucky that affect burial or cremation?

Yes, Kentucky state regulations apply in Oil Springs, such as requiring a death certificate before burial or cremation and a 24-hour waiting period for cremation unless waived. Local cemeteries in Johnson County may have specific rules regarding burial vaults or plot reservations, so it's important to check with both the funeral home and cemetery.

Q4.How can I pre-plan a funeral in Oil Springs, and are there benefits to doing so locally?

Pre-planning a funeral in Oil Springs involves meeting with a local funeral home to select services and set aside funds, often through a prepaid plan or insurance. Benefits include locking in current prices, easing the burden on family, and ensuring your wishes are honored according to Kentucky's preneed funeral contract laws, which offer consumer protections.

Q5.What should I consider when choosing a funeral home in Oil Springs, Kentucky?

When selecting a funeral home in Oil Springs, consider factors like location convenience, service options (e.g., whether they offer cremation on-site), reputation in the community, and compliance with Kentucky regulations. Visiting local homes, such as those serving Johnson County, can help you assess their facilities and staff responsiveness to your needs.

Understanding the Role of Your Funeral Director in Oil Springs, Kentucky

Helpful insights about funeral services in Oil Springs, Kentucky

When a loved one passes away in our close-knit community of Oil Springs, Kentucky, families are often faced with a multitude of decisions during a time of profound grief. In these moments, a compassionate and knowledgeable funeral director becomes an invaluable guide. More than just a coordinator of services, your local funeral director serves as a steady hand, a source of comfort, and a professional dedicated to honoring a life with dignity and respect. Understanding their role can help families in Johnson County navigate this difficult journey with greater clarity and peace of mind.

At its heart, the work of a funeral director in Oil Springs is deeply personal and community-focused. They begin by meeting with your family, often in the comfort of your own home or at their funeral home, to listen to your stories, your wishes, and your concerns. This initial arrangement conference is where they gather the necessary information to file the death certificate with the state of Kentucky and handle other vital legal documentation, lifting that administrative burden from your shoulders. They will gently walk you through the options available, from traditional funeral services at a local church to more contemporary celebrations of life, always tailoring their guidance to reflect your family's values, faith, and budget.

Your funeral director's care extends far beyond paperwork and logistics. They are responsible for the respectful care and preparation of your loved one, a sacred duty they perform with the utmost professionalism. They coordinate with cemeteries in the area, like those in nearby Paintsville or Staffordsville, and manage all the details of the service itself, from arranging floral tributes to ensuring the music and readings proceed smoothly. For many families in our area, having a familiar, trusted professional who understands our Appalachian traditions and the importance of family gatherings is a profound comfort. They help create a meaningful farewell that truly reflects the individual who has passed.

In the days and weeks following the service, your funeral director's role often continues. They can provide resources for grief support, help with obituaries for the Paintsville Herald or other local papers, and assist with matters like veteran's benefits or insurance claims. Choosing a funeral director in Oil Springs means choosing a neighbor who is committed to serving your family with integrity and compassion, not just during the services, but as you begin to heal. They stand beside you, ensuring that every detail is handled with care, allowing you the space to focus on remembering, honoring, and supporting one another through your loss.
